Error ATi Display Driver Installation Problem on Suse 11.0

i have installed OpenSuse 11.0
downloaded catalyst 8.9 for linux.
installed as per instructions on amd site....
installation was successful according to the catalyst installation..
[i could notice that the driver was installed (mayb) as i could increase the screen resolution beyond what was available prior to the installation of catalyst]
but when i start the catalyst control centre... i get the following error..



also when i try to enable desktop effect for compiz fusion... the screen bcoms white..
then i have 2 restart 2 get back to the desktop. (or either disable it by unckecking the box ...guesswork on a white screen..)



i would like to know how to get the driver installed properly in order to enable desktop effects...
ty in advance

EDIT:- installation was done by command $su root ./<dloaded *.run file>
